§ 4215A Sentence of greater punishment because of previous conviction under prior law or the laws of other jurisdictions.

11 DE Code § 4215A (2019) (N/A)
Copy with citation
Copy as parenthetical citation

(a) Notwithstanding any provision of law to the contrary, if a previous conviction for a specified offense would make the defendant liable to a punishment greater than that which may be imposed upon a person not so convicted, that previous conviction shall make the defendant liable to the greater punishment if that previous conviction was:

(1) For an offense specified in the laws of this State or for an offense which is the same as, or equivalent to, such offense as the same existed and was defined under the laws of this State existing at the time of such conviction; or

(2) For an offense specified in the laws of any other state, local jurisdiction, the United States, any territory of the United States, any federal or military reservation, or the District of Columbia which is the same as, or equivalent to, an offense specified in the laws of this State.

(b) This section shall apply to any offense or sentencing provision defined in this Code unless the statute defining such offense or sentencing provision or a statute directly related thereto expressly provides that this section is not applicable to such offense or sentencing provision.

74 Del. Laws, c. 62, § 1.
